Bikers Blessing 2009

Great springtime weather prompted more than 1,000 bikers (including Bob and me) to ride to Tionesta PA the afternoon of May 3, 2009 for its annual bikers blessing. It was an enjoyable ride from our home to the bikers blessing and back. Most of the way we ride alongside the Allegheny River. Views of the river and the towering hills beyond the river make for a picturesque ride.

As in years past, the bikers blessing was held at Word of Grace Church located a mile up German Hill Road. We arrived later than usual, so we were directed to the overflow parking lot — alongside a cornfield, in the back yard of a house across the street from the church.

Our motorcycle is the one holding two silver helmets.

The church lot was jammed pack full of motorcycles and people.

 

The 3:00 PM event started with a word of prayer, followed by the reading of a couple passages from the Bible. A moment of silence, followed by a song (“Amazing Grace”) and a prayer, was held for bikers who had died during the past riding season. All bikers were then asked to form a circle around the motorcycles for a common prayer. Bob and I joined the bikers in the overflow parking lot and encircled our motorcycles, while those who had parked at the church encircled their motorcycles.

 

Circling the motorcycles

 

After the common prayer we went to our individual bikes where folks from the Christian Motorcyclist Association met with individual riders and said a word of prayer with them. After our individual prayer we received a sticker proclaiming “I was blessed in ’09”.
